SDROxide: A New SDR Client for HAMs and SWLs written in Rust

Thank you to Josef (OE3JJS) for writing in and sharing with us the release of his new open-source software called SDROxide, an SDR client designed for HAMs and SWLs (short-wave listeners), written in Rust. The software supports Linux, Windows, macOS, and also has a web client. As it supports SoapySDR, RTL-SDR dongles are supported for RX. Josef writes about SDROxide:

It's a completely new project written in Rust, supporting many SDR interfaces (CAT/Audio, CAT/IQ, SoapySDR, HPSDR, TCI) and with loads of features built in that used to require extra programs: FT8/FT4, SSTV, RTTY, PSK, OLIVIA, THOR, FSQ, a CW/RTTY/PSK skimmer, there's dx cluster and sota/pota spotting, a logbook with integrations for QRZ.com, HamQTH, eQSL, LoTW, there's neural-network noise reduction, a 3D "hamclock" that visualizes QSOs, satellites, Aurora, CME cones, with up-to-date images of the sun's surface, and you can run the client locally, remote with native binary, or remote via the web (WASM).

Josef notes that the project is fully open-source and available on GitHub.

TechMinds: Testing the GA-450 Portable HF Active Loop Antenna

Over on the Techminds YouTube channel, Matt has uploaded his latest video which is a review of the GA-450 portable HF active loop antenna. The antenna costs between US$60-$80 + shipping and is available on Chinese market sites like Aliexpress and Banggood. It's advertised as covering 2.3 - 30 MHz, and uses a very portable and sturdy 20cm stainless steel loop. The active base amplifier is powered via a USB-C connector, and it even has a built in lithium battery for portable field use.

In his review Matt shows the antenna in action, noting that it's performance is quite a lot better than expected for it's small size, but it can't compare to his large half-wave end fed antenna. He notes that it appears to work best from 7 - 21 MHz, but not so well below 7 MHz. Overall he recommends it if you're looking for a small sized loop antenna.
